jp: option '-c' is not longer a flag but a string to define the profile password:
- no '-c': same behavior as before, do not connect the profile
- '-c' with not following value: autoconnect and use the default value '' as profile password
- '-c' with a following value: autoconnect and use that value as profile password
Note that previous scripts may not work. For example, even if the profile password for "test1" is empty:
jp disco -p test1 -c contact@host.net
must be changed to:
jp disco -p test1 -c -- contact@host.net
Otherwise, argparse will think that "contact@host.net" is the password and that the target JID is missing.
